在一家跨國科技公司工作的經(jīng)歷讓我明白了一個道理:創(chuàng)新的過程往往比很多人所預想的要花費更長的時間,但也會比人們想象的要更具突破性。我們正親眼目睹這股創(chuàng)新動力在數(shù)字技術領域的體現(xiàn)——包括因特網(wǎng)、移動技術和設備、數(shù)據(jù)分析、人工智能,以及數(shù)字化傳輸服務與應用程序——這些技術正在從根本上重塑世界上貧困人口的生活方式。1Translationofthetexts數(shù)字農(nóng)業(yè)UNIT4ReadingReading

如果要舉例說明哪個市場對貧困人口不友好,那就是農(nóng)業(yè)市場。但是數(shù)字技術可以改變這一點。2TranslationofthetextsUNIT43目前,有數(shù)億非洲人以農(nóng)業(yè)為生,但是他們沒辦法盡可能多地種植作物,也沒辦法盡可能多地賣出剩余的作物。這導致非洲每年不得不花費數(shù)十億美元來進口食物,例如,谷類(大米、玉米和小麥)、食用油、糖和甜食,以及畜牧產(chǎn)品(乳制品和肉類)。這些產(chǎn)品本可以利用非洲富饒的農(nóng)業(yè)和土地資源實現(xiàn)本地化生產(chǎn)。非洲大陸有一半的勞動力都在從事農(nóng)業(yè)生產(chǎn),但他們還得從別處購買食物,這說明有些地方存在問題。ReadingReading

是哪里出了錯呢?為什么非洲的小農(nóng)場主無法進入這個潛力巨大的市場4TranslationofthetextsUNIT45主要問題在于,農(nóng)業(yè)市場像銀行一樣是規(guī)范化管理,而小農(nóng)場主則是非規(guī)范化經(jīng)營。因此,農(nóng)民和市場之間并不能進行有效溝通。小農(nóng)場主不知道市場價格,也不能根據(jù)市場的具體需求來種植糧食,因為他們并不了解具體要求是什么。他們也沒有途徑學習能夠讓產(chǎn)量翻倍甚至翻三倍的農(nóng)場管理措施。結果,他們種植的大多是自己能吃的,或者能在本地交易的食物,就像他們一直以來所做的那樣。ReadingReading

只要這種信息斷層存在,相關的實體溝通斷層就會存在。因為農(nóng)民種植作物的方式以及作物產(chǎn)量不是市場所需,所以不會有鐵路和道路將作物從農(nóng)場運到市場。因此,農(nóng)民被孤立在自己的小天地里,沒有資金,也沒有市場能夠聽到他們的聲音。6TranslationofthetextsUNIT6ReadingReading

然而,數(shù)字科技可以像一個秘密解碼環(huán)一樣,將正規(guī)的市場與不正規(guī)的小農(nóng)場主連接起來?,F(xiàn)在小農(nóng)場主已經(jīng)能使用手機,通過網(wǎng)絡和家人及朋友交流。正規(guī)市場中各個機構也是用同樣方式溝通。因此,在非洲的生產(chǎn)者和消費者之間開辟一條雙向的溝通渠道是可能的——這也是一種全新的交流。這將會是雙方第一次能夠直接向對方表達自己的需求。7TranslationofthetextsUNIT7ReadingReading

試想一下,一個小農(nóng)場主能夠輕易地知道今年山藥能夠賣出高價。她便可以聯(lián)系當?shù)氐暮献魃?,將她的山藥和臨近農(nóng)場主的山藥合起來售賣,進而滿足購買者龐大的需求量。如果她確信在豐收時會有銷量,她就有能力通過手機申請貸款,用以購買肥料、更好的存儲空間,或者其他能夠最大限度提高產(chǎn)量的東西。期間,她還可以通過數(shù)字網(wǎng)絡視頻或者文字獲取根據(jù)其作物和土壤類型量身定制的建議,而不是等待技術推廣員上門來幫忙——他們也未必了解該地區(qū)的山藥和土壤的狀況。8TranslationofthetextsUNIT4ReadingReading

正如金融交易數(shù)字化可以大幅度降低交易成本一樣,當信息傳播變得暢通,數(shù)據(jù)獲取變得普遍,農(nóng)業(yè)產(chǎn)銷的成本也會大大降低。農(nóng)民、農(nóng)業(yè)綜合企業(yè)、合作社在管控與陌生合作伙伴做生意的風險方面投入過多時間和資金,其實是對生產(chǎn)效率的阻礙。當這些生意伙伴彼此熟悉——能夠在單一市場中像網(wǎng)絡上的各個節(jié)點一樣互相連接、協(xié)作配合——農(nóng)業(yè)將會蓬勃發(fā)展。9TranslationofthetextsUNIT4ReadingReading
